Types of Braces Available in India (2025)

Braces come in different styles and materials, each with its own benefits, aesthetics, and costs.

1. Metal Braces (Traditional Braces)

  • Description: Stainless steel brackets and wires fixed to the teeth.

  • Advantages: Strong, effective for complex cases, cost-effective.

  • Cost Range in India (2025): ₹30,000 – ₹60,000

2. Ceramic Braces

  • Description: Tooth-colored brackets that blend with natural teeth.

  • Advantages: Less visible than metal braces, effective for most cases.

  • Cost Range in India (2025): ₹50,000 – ₹80,000

3. Lingual Braces

  • Description: Placed behind the teeth, making them invisible from the front.

  • Advantages: Aesthetic appeal, good for people who want discreet treatment.

  • Cost Range in India (2025): ₹80,000 – ₹2,00,000

4. Self-Ligating Braces

  • Description: Use a special clip instead of elastic bands to hold the wire.

  • Advantages: Less friction, shorter treatment time in some cases.

  • Cost Range in India (2025): ₹55,000 – ₹90,000

5. Clear Aligners (e.g., Invisalign)

  • Description: Transparent, removable trays custom-made for your teeth.

  • Advantages: Almost invisible, removable, comfortable.

  • Cost Range in India (2025): ₹1,50,000 – ₹4,00,000

Factors That Affect Braces Cost in India

Several elements influence the price you pay for braces in India:

1. Type of Braces Chosen

Metal braces are the most affordable, while clear aligners and lingual braces are on the higher end of the price range.

2. Complexity of the Case

Severe misalignment, bite correction, or jaw issues require longer treatment, increasing the cost.

3. Orthodontist’s Experience

Highly experienced orthodontists may charge more due to their expertise and success rate.

4. Location of the Clinic

Dental treatment costs vary across Indian cities. Metro cities generally have higher charges compared to smaller towns.

5. Treatment Duration

The average treatment time is 18–24 months, but complex cases can take longer, increasing the total cost.

6. Additional Treatments

Some patients may require tooth extractions, fillings, or other dental procedures before starting braces, which adds to the cost.

Average Braces Cost in India (2025) – City-Wise Comparison

CityMetal BracesCeramic BracesLingual BracesClear Aligners
Delhi₹35k – ₹60k₹55k – ₹85k₹85k – ₹1.8L₹1.6L – ₹3.8L
Mumbai₹40k – ₹65k₹60k – ₹90k₹90k – ₹2L₹1.7L – ₹4L
Bangalore₹35k – ₹60k₹55k – ₹85k₹85k – ₹1.9L₹1.5L – ₹3.7L
Chennai₹32k – ₹58k₹52k – ₹80k₹80k – ₹1.8L₹1.4L – ₹3.6L
Kolkata₹30k – ₹55k₹50k – ₹78k₹78k – ₹1.7L₹1.4L – ₹3.5L
Hyderabad₹33k – ₹57k₹53k – ₹82k₹82k – ₹1.8L₹1.5L – ₹3.6L

(Note: Prices are approximate and can vary depending on clinic and orthodontist.)

Braces Cost vs. Quality of Treatment

While affordability is important, choosing braces solely based on low cost can compromise treatment results. It’s essential to consider:

  • Qualifications of the orthodontist

  • Reputation of the clinic

  • Technology used in treatment

  • Follow-up care availability

Tips to Save Money on Braces in India

  1. Compare Multiple Clinics – Get quotes from at least 3–4 orthodontists before deciding.

  2. Consider Dental Colleges – They offer treatment at lower rates under supervision of experienced faculty.

  3. Opt for EMI Plans – Many clinics provide monthly installment options.

  4. Choose the Right Braces Type – If budget is tight, metal braces are effective and more affordable.

  5. Check for Insurance Coverage – Some dental insurance plans in India may cover partial orthodontic costs for children.

Is It Worth Traveling to Another City for Braces?

For patients living in smaller towns, traveling to a nearby metro city can mean better treatment options and advanced technology. However, factor in:

  • Travel costs

  • Frequency of visits (usually every 4–6 weeks)

  • Comfort level with the orthodontist

Braces for Adults: Is the Cost Different?

In India, the cost for adult braces is usually the same as for teenagers, but adults may require:

  • Longer treatment duration

  • More complex bite correction

  • Clear aligner options for discretion (which cost more)
